You failed to count all the myriad aspects of minds that have reductionst explanations. Consciousness is what's left.

I don't see how this alters the claim that the continuing absence of a reductive theory of consciousness is evidence against reductionism. Counting all the myriad aspects doesn't change that fact, and thatt's the only claim I made. I didn't say that the continuing absence of a reduction has demonstrated that reductionism is false. I'm only claiming that Pr(Reductionism | No Reduction of Consciousness available) < Pr(Reductionism).

I think the existence of the Bible is evidence for Jesus's divinity. That doesn't mean I'm discounting the overwhelming evidence telling against his divinity.
